How to make table of contents macro appear in page properties report

Guuglette Moibooty April 11, 2018

Hi, 

 

I've included a table of contents in the page property box on a page, listing all headlines.

I have also created an overview page with a page properties report on another page. 

The table of contents does not show in the report. 

Is it at all possible to include macro generated data into the page properties report?

And if so, how can it be done?

I created a table with columns and values on a page template which is used multiple times. This table on each page is surrounded by a properties macro.
One value of that table is the TOC at H2 only to show a list of contents of the page.

When I now try to create a page prop report on one single page then that TOC column value (actual TOC of the pages) is shown properly within the edit screen for the page prop report. But when saving it, then the TOC is not shown at all, looks like an issue with the resolution of the macro in another macro. But why does it work and show up as expected in the preview within the edit page prop report screen?
